angular-strap选择和datepicker是否支持i18n?

时间:2014-05-13 12:27:22

标签: angular-ui-bootstrap angular-strap

我有一个角度带选择定义如下:

<button type="button" class="btn btn-primary" ng-model="idMedecin"
        ng-options="medecin.id as medecin.titre+' '+ medecin.prenom+' '+medecin.nom for medecin in model.medecins"
        data-placeholder="{{model.placeholder}}" bs-select>
  Action <span class="caret"></span>
</button>

在控制器中,每当用户选择另一种语言(i18n)时,我会更改[model.placeholder]的值,例如从[Choisissezunmédecin]到[选择医生]。但是,此更改不会出现在选择按钮上。

如何传播到选择按钮,即在模型上完成的更改?

我对angular-strap datepicker有完全相同的问题:

<input type="text" ng-model="model.jour" class="form-control btn-warning"
           data-min-date="today"
           data-date-format="fullDate"
           data-autoclose="true"
           data-date-type="number"
           data-use-native="true"
           bs-datepicker/>

第一次显示时,此组件正确使用当前语言。当用户更改此语言时,我使用新的语言环境更改[$ locale.id]。然而,日期选择器不会刷新新日历。

0 个答案:

没有答案